Treatment
Services
All
Sobriety Works programs seek to educate clients on chemical
dependency, relapse, and recovery through lecture, film, writing
assignments and literature.
The group process aids clients to formulate solutions and internalize
recovery principles. Each client is carefully assessed and works
with their specific Case Manager to establish an individualized
treatment plan.
All
clients are required to attend 12-Step meetings, establish a sober
support system, and develop a personalized relapse prevention plan
prior to program completion. Attendance at alternative recovery
group sessions may be accepted in place of 12-Step meetings. Clients
are regularly and randomly drug tested throughout treatment.
Additionally,
clients have the option to engage in individual, couples and/or
family counseling sessions. Two sessions per treatment episode are
included in the cost of the program. Additional counseling sessions
may be arranged.
Day
Treatment
Day
Treatment is our most intensive program, for clients seeking the
additional structure of daily sessions. Our Day Treatment program
meets Monday-Friday, four hours per day, for six weeks (total of
30 sessions).

Intensive
Outpatient Counseling (IOC)
Designed
for clients in the work force, IOP consists of 36 chemical dependency
sessions over the course of 12 weeks. Groups meet three evenings
per week for three hours per session.

Relapse
Prevention Treatment (RPT)
Based
on the work of Terry Gorski, RPT focuses on relapse dynamics. Clients
must meet the RPT placement criteria including previous treatment
episodes and/or prior long term sobriety. Clients work more in-depth
at identifying and developing strategies to address relapse triggers
and cues. RPT consists of 36 sessions over the course of 12 weeks
with groups meeting three evenings per week for three hours per
session.

After
Care
Research
has shown that clients continuing in After Care following completion
of primary treatment have a better rate of recovery. Sobriety Works
clients are encouraged to attend weekly After Care Sessions for
one year. After Care meets once per week and is free to Sobriety
Works alumni.
Alternative to Incarceration
(ATI)
Our
ATI clients attend treatment and live in one of our SLEs in lieu
of serving jail time. Once approved by the courts, clients can get
credit for time served upon successful completion of the program.
